Compartilhar via


função WDF_REL_TIMEOUT_IN_SEC (wdfcore.h)

[Aplica-se a KMDF e UMDF]

A função WDF_REL_TIMEOUT_IN_SEC converte um número especificado de segundos em um valor de tempo relativo.

Sintaxe

WDF_EXTERN_C_START LONGLONG WDF_REL_TIMEOUT_IN_SEC(
  [in] ULONGLONG Time
);

Parâmetros

[in] Time

O número de segundos a serem convertidos.

Valor de retorno

WDF_REL_TIMEOUT_IN_SEC retorna o valor de tempo relativo, em unidades de tempo do sistema (intervalos de 100 nanossegundos), que representa o número de segundos que especifica tempo.

Observações

Um tempo relativo é um valor de tempo relativo ao tempo atual do sistema. Por exemplo, se um chamador passar um valor de tempo relativo de cinco segundos para uma função que aceita um valor de tempo limite, a função terá um tempo limite de cinco segundos após ser chamada.

Exemplos

O exemplo de código a seguir especifica um valor de tempo limite relativo de 5 segundos para uma solicitação de E/S.

WDF_REQUEST_SEND_OPTIONS  requestSendOptions;
...
requestSendOptions.Timeout = WDF_REL_TIMEOUT_IN_SEC(5);
...

Requisitos

Requisito Valor
da Plataforma de Destino Universal
versão mínima do KMDF 1.0
versão mínima do UMDF 2.0
cabeçalho wdfcore.h (inclua Wdf.h)
biblioteca Nenhum
IRQL Qualquer nível

Consulte também

WDF_ABS_TIMEOUT_IN_SEC

WDF_REQUEST_SEND_OPTIONS